Floods can impact the hydrosphere by altering the flow of water in rivers and lakes, increasing sediment and nutrient transport, and potentially causing erosion and water contamination. They can also disrupt aquatic ecosystems and affect water quality.

Floods can contaminate water sources with pollutants and bacteria, making it unsafe to drink without treatment. It can also damage water infrastructure, causing disruptions in access to clean water. This can lead to increased risk of waterborne diseases and scarcity of safe drinking water for affected communities.

The Queensland floods caused an influx of excess water into the hydrosphere, resulting in widespread inundation of land, contamination of water sources, and disruption to aquatic ecosystems. The increased volume of water also led to erosion and sedimentation, impacting water quality and aquatic habitats.
